PM Modi’s Pledge Against Corruption Echoes at Karauli Rally

Karauli, Rajasthan – Prime Minister Narendra Modi, in a recent public rally in Karauli, Rajasthan, reaffirmed his commitment to the fight against corruption, promising stringent action across the nation.

“Strict action is being taken against corruption all over the country,” Modi proclaimed, emphasizing his government’s relentless efforts to root out corruption. This statement comes at a time when the country is witnessing a series of corruption scandals, and the government’s resolve to tackle them is being put to the test.

Modi also took a jibe at the opposition, which he referred to as the “INDI Alliance”. He remarked, “The people of INDI Alliance are getting together against Modi. On one hand, there is Modi who calls to remove corruption, and on the other hand, it is them who want to save the corrupt.”

His comments drew a stark contrast between his government’s anti-corruption initiatives and the opposition’s alleged attempts to protect those involved in corrupt practices. The crowd responded with cheers, reflecting their support for his anti-corruption campaign.

“No matter how many threats are given to Modi, the corrupt have to go to jail. This is Modi’s guarantee,” he asserted, sending a strong message to those engaged in corrupt activities and promising stringent action.

The rally forms part of Modi’s broader campaign against corruption, a key promise of his tenure as Prime Minister. His speech today served to reiterate his commitment to this cause and sent a clear message to the opposition and those involved in corruption: there will be no tolerance for corruption.

As the nation watches, the impact of these measures in the fight against corruption remains to be seen.
